Description
Check Uber fare surges around you on a map and receive periodic notifications (customizable threshold minimum) whenever surge pricing takes effect. Check specific pickup locations for surge pricing by tapping and holding on the map, or check for surge pricing within four directions of you all at once on the visible map. Ideal for Uber drivers looking to earn more than a regular drive's fare.Covers all areas serviced by Uber.

FREE TRIAL LIMITATIONS:
- Limit of 1 mile radius around current location for checking surge near you (up to 3mi radius in full version)
- Limit of 10 push notifications for surge fares near your or at custom checkpoints
- 1 week of app access to the app (will self-disable after a week)

Q: What is an APK File?
A: Just like Windows (PC) systems use an .exe file for installing software, Android does the same. An APK file is the file format used for installing software on the Android operating system.
Q: If I install an APK from this website, will I be able to update the app from the Play Store?
A: Yes, absolutely. The Play Store installs APKs it downloads from Google's servers, and sideloading from a site like ApkClean.net goes through a very similar process, except you're the one performing the downloading and initiating the installation (sideloading).
As soon as the Play Store finds a version of the app newer than the one you've sideloaded, it will commence an update.
